Carving Totem Poles and Masks by Alan and Gill Bridgewater
Carve full-size or in miniature the majestic totem poles and masks of the Native Americans from the Pacific Northwest. Discover the dramatically crisp forms, the incredible balance of shape and color, the sweeping beauty, and the control of craftsmanship that has been handed down for centuries. 20 projects include a sea-otter bowl, a decorative panel for a burial box, and a sacred thunderbird mask.
